Actually whilst I'm here I have a quick question - for those of you with 3.0 petrol engined BMWs, is it advisable or worthwhile using super unleaded or will regular fuel suffice? When I bought the car the salesman could only tell me that it would "run on either".

It'll go like stink on either basically. I used Optimax in the last tankfull and the economy seemed about 10% better but I've not noticed much difference in performance to be honest.

There was a good article in evo a while back and there's a lot of different factors involved - best advice was to use a busy petrol station as the fuel can 'go off' if it lies around for a while ...
